LINGO在电力系统机组组合优化中的应用

摘    要:电力系统机组组合是一个高维数、非凸、离散、非线性的混合整数优化问题。本文介绍了LINGO软件优化方法及在电力机组组合优化中的应用。建立电力系统机组组合的优化模型,结合3母线电力系统实例,采用LINGO求解优化模型,验证了该方法的可行性和有效性。LINGO为电力机组组合优化提供了一个新的方法,具有很好的应用前景。

Application of LINGO to Power System Unit Commitment Optimization

Abstract:Unit commitment(UC) is a large scale,discrete and non-linear mixed integer optimization problem.The optimization method by using LINGO is presented, as well as the application of LINGO to the power system unit commitment optimization problems.The feasibility and validity of this method were proved by case study on a power system with three bus units.LINGO provides a new solution to power system unit commitment optimization problems and has a promising application prospect.
